How It Works
When you add essential oils to your bucket of water, they vaporize along with the steam. As you inhale, these natural compounds travel directly to your brain’s limbic system, which is responsible for regulating emotions. That’s why certain scents, such as eucalyptus or birch, can instantly shift your mood from stressed to relaxed.
Best Scents for Sauna Use
Eucalyptus: Perfect for opening the airways and creating a refreshing “breathe easy” feeling. It’s an excellent choice for post-workout recovery.
Birch: A classic Nordic scent that evokes the freshness of the forest. It is ideal for relaxing muscles and grounding the mind.
Lavender: If you use your sauna before bedtime, lavender is the perfect choice to help your body relax and prepare for deep sleep.
Tip for Beginners
Always dilute essential oils in a ladle of water before pouring them onto the sauna stones. Never apply concentrated oil directly to the heater, as it may create a fire hazard. A little goes a long way! Just 3–4 drops in a full bucket of water will provide a subtle and relaxing fragrance that fills the entire sauna.
